2020 Tennessee Tech Golden Eagles football team
The 2020 Tennessee Tech Golden Eagles football team represented Tennessee Technological University in the 2020–21 NCAA Division I FCS football season. They were led by third-year head coach Dewayne Alexander and played their home games at Tucker Stadium. They competed as a member of the Ohio Valley Conference.

Previous season
The Golden Eagles finished the 2019 season 6–6, 3–5 in OVC play to finish in a tie for fifth place.
Schedule
Tennessee Tech had games scheduled against Minnesota (September 12) and North Carolina Central (September 19), which were canceled before the start of the 2020 season.[1][2]
